Additive manufactured (or 3D printed) materials suffer from internal defects due to their production procedures. To ensure the safety of additive manufactured components, proper structural health monitoring methods are needed. This thesis shows the feasibility of acoustic emission testing in monitoring internal defects of additive manufactured components and studies waveform related features of collected activities. It also provides a deeper understanding of acoustic emission sources from pencil lead break signals and fatigue crack progressions.
